одновременный доступ к MySQL

Работа VB и СУБД (Access, MSSQL, MySQL, Oracle и пр.)
Правила форума
При создании новой темы не забывайте указывать используемую СУБД.
JIeT4uK
Продвинутый пользователь
Продвинутый пользователь
 
Сообщения: 145
Зарегистрирован: 23.03.2003 (Вс) 4:48
Откуда: Украина, Донецк

одновременный доступ к MySQL

Сообщение JIeT4uK » 09.04.2005 (Сб) 23:08

как отреагирует база если одновременно с сотни компов попытаться увеличить значение одной ячейки на 1. Получиться +100 или нет???

Konst_One
Член-корреспондент академии VBStreets
Член-корреспондент академии VBStreets
Аватара пользователя
 
Сообщения: 3041
Зарегистрирован: 09.04.2004 (Пт) 13:47
Откуда: Химки

Сообщение Konst_One » 10.04.2005 (Вс) 10:28

в реалиционных системах управления базами данных есть такое понятие как ТРАНЗАКЦИЯ и БЛОКИРОВКА
в твоем случае запись будет заблокирована первым пользователем, который будет делать апдейт указанной ячейки таблицы и, в зависимости, от выбранного метода блокировки, остальные пользователи смогут только смотреть старое значение или вообще не смогут получить доступ к данной таблице/записи пока не завершится транзакция на ее обновление

alibek
Большой Человек
Большой Человек
 
Сообщения: 14205
Зарегистрирован: 19.04.2002 (Пт) 11:40
Откуда: Russia

Сообщение alibek » 10.04.2005 (Вс) 11:17

Konst_One, только один маленький ньюанс -- в MySQL нет транзакций :)
Lasciate ogni speranza, voi ch'entrate.

JIeT4uK
Продвинутый пользователь
Продвинутый пользователь
 
Сообщения: 145
Зарегистрирован: 23.03.2003 (Вс) 4:48
Откуда: Украина, Донецк

Сообщение JIeT4uK » 10.04.2005 (Вс) 15:15

так все же что произойдет??? от этого зависит стоит браться за написание или нет

Ennor
Конструктивный критик
Конструктивный критик
 
Сообщения: 2504
Зарегистрирован: 18.12.2001 (Вт) 3:58
Откуда: Калуга -> Москва

Сообщение Ennor » 10.04.2005 (Вс) 15:30

alibek писал(а):Konst_One, только один маленький ньюанс -- в MySQL нет транзакций :)
Не поверишь, alibek, но в 5.0 они вроде как появляются :)

JIeT4uK писал(а):так все же что произойдет??? от этого зависит стоит браться за написание или нет
Зависит от того, что именно тебе нужно. Ты не бойся, выкладывай все требования, тут имеется опытный пипл, которые тебе помогут.


Вернуться в Базы данных

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 2

    TopList